Understanding CNC Precision Turning
CNC, or Computer Numerical Control, is a technology that automates machining tools through computer programming. This process allows for precise control of machinery, resulting in increased accuracy and efficiency. Precision turning involves the shaping of material into cylindrical forms, a process crucial in manufacturing components for a wide array of applications.
The Process of Precision Turning
The process begins with selecting the appropriate material, often metals such as aluminum, steel, brass, and titanium, due to their machinability and strength properties. Following are the key steps involved in precision turning:
- Material Selection: Choosing a suitable alloy based on mechanical properties.
- CAD Design: Using Computer-Aided Design (CAD) software to create the blueprint of the part.
- CNC Programming: Translating CAD designs into machine code that guides the CNC machine.
- Machining: The CNC machine precisely cuts and shapes the material according to the programmed instructions.
- Finishing: Applying surface treatments such as polishing or coating for enhanced durability and aesthetics.
The Benefits of CNC Precision Turning Parts
Opting for CNC precision turning parts brings numerous advantages that include:
- High Accuracy: CNC machines can achieve tolerances as tight as ±0.001 inches, making them ideal for applications where precision is paramount.
- Repeatability: Once a part is programmed, the CNC machine can replicate the process multiple times with the same accuracy, ensuring consistency.
- Complex Geometries: CNC technology enables the creation of complex shapes that would be difficult or impossible to achieve with traditional machining methods.
- Reduced Waste: Advanced programming and machining techniques minimize material waste, making the process more economical.
- Faster Production Times: CNC machines operate much faster than manual processes, significantly reducing lead times for production.
Applications of CNC Precision Turning Parts
The versatility of CNC precision turning parts allows them to be utilized across a multitude of industries, including:
Aerospace Industry
In the aerospace sector, companies require components that can withstand extreme conditions. CNC precision turning parts are utilized in the manufacturing of:
- Engine components
- Fuel systems
- Landing gear
Automotive Industry
The automotive industry relies heavily on CNC precision turning to produce:
- Brake components
- Shafts and linkages
- Transmission parts
Medical Devices
Precision turning is crucial in the medical field, where parts must be manufactured to extreme accuracy. Applications include:
- Implants
- Surgical instruments
- Diagnostic equipment
